56# Disable -fstrict-aliasing. Darwin disables it by default (and LLVM doesn't
57# work with it enabled with GCC), Clang/llvm-gc don't support it yet, and newer
58# GCC's have false positive warnings with it on Linux (which prove a pain to
59# fix). For example:
60#   http://gcc.gnu.org/PR41874
61#   http://gcc.gnu.org/PR41838
62#
63# We can revisit this when LLVM/Clang support it.
64CXX.Flags += -fno-strict-aliasing
